that's how I found it



and was thinking of geting faster with my quartermile that at the moment was 12.39...
so I began mid engined trabant project
the car from factory had only 615 kilos on it.... then I choped the back of it... and added the front of an escort (I know it has been done so many times, but never to a trabant )



will put my Zvh in it or maybe I will assemble full zetec turbo till I finish the body
